PIN BADGE COLLECTION - USSR, WORLD WAR, & HISTORICAL FIGURES FEATURING LENIN, GORBACHEV & POPE PIUS XII
This lot includes all of the following items in a cardboard constructed, leather-lined, glass faced, vintage display case. Backed with purple cloth and white batting.
Mikhail Gorbachev Metal Pin “The First President of the USSR”
USSR Soviet Badge feat. a double-headed Eagle over the colors of the Russian Flag
WWII German Fast Attack Craft War Badge, awarded to Kriegsmarine Members
Pair of Vintage Chinese PLA (People’s Liberation Army) Collar Tabs, Awarded to “Officers”, circa late 20th century
Vladimir Lenin Pin Badge, reverse side markings read “15k” and an “M” over a “W”
Vladimir Lenin Pin Badge, red enamel on yellow gold-colored metal pin, reverse side markings read “15k”
Vladimir Lenin Pin Badge, red enamel on yellow gold-colored metal, reverse side marking appears to be a horseshoe shape
Vladimir Lenin Pin Badge, red enamel on yellow gold-colored, flag shaped, metal pin
Soviet Military Badge, “Motorized Rifle Troops (Motostrelkovye Voiska)” USSR erc, enamel on gold-colored metal
Soviet Pin Badge “1986 Year of Peace”, enamel on yellow gold-colored metal, reverse side markings read “15k”
Catholic Medal feat. Pope Pius XII, likely silvered bronze, reverse side features the “Holy Family”
Embroidered Japanese Army Officer Bevo Field Cap Star Patch, WWII-era, used on field caps and sun helmets
Jubilee Medal “70 Years of the Armed Forces of the USSR”, awarded to military personnel, workers, and veterans
Pin Badge Commemorating the Zeppelin’s Visit to the 1993 World’s Fair in Chicago, German, likely event souvenir
